Solutions for "cast off crossword" by Letter Count

4 Letters

SHED: To discard or let fall off, often used for animals shedding fur, trees shedding leaves, or even shedding a habit.

DOFF: To take off (one's hat or an item of clothing), particularly in a polite gesture, often found in older literature or specific contexts.

5 Letters

EJECT: To force or throw (something or someone) out, implying a more forceful removal than simply casting off.

7 Letters

DISCARD: To throw away or get rid of something no longer wanted or useful, a direct synonym for casting off unwanted items.

More About "cast off crossword"

"Cast off" is a versatile phrase that can appear in crosswords with several meanings, making it a potentially tricky clue. Its most common interpretations involve discarding, abandoning, or removing something. For instance, you might "cast off" old clothes, "cast off" a fishing line from a boat, or even "cast off" from a dock when a ship departs. The key to solving such clues often lies in considering the surrounding letters and the overall theme of the puzzle, as well as the specific number of letters required for the answer.

Beyond its literal meanings, "cast off" can sometimes be used metaphorically in puzzles, referring to letting go of feelings, inhibitions, or old ideas. Understanding these nuances helps in identifying the correct synonym, whether it's a simple 'SHED' for discarding or a more formal 'DOFF' for removing an item of clothing. Crossword constructors love these multi-faceted words to test your vocabulary and contextual reasoning.

Frequently Asked Questions

What does "cast off" typically mean in crosswords?

In crosswords, "cast off" usually refers to discarding, removing, or getting rid of something. It can apply to clothing, a burden, an old idea, or even a boat being launched (casting off from the dock). The specific context of the clue and surrounding letters often helps narrow down the exact meaning.

Are there common word lengths for "cast off" answers?

Answers for "cast off" can vary widely in length, from short words like SHED (4 letters) or DOFF (4 letters) to longer ones like DISCARD (7 letters) or ABANDON (7 letters). It's always best to check the letter count provided in the puzzle.

How can I distinguish between similar "cast off" clues?

Pay attention to nuances. If the clue implies removing an article of clothing, 'DOFF' is a strong contender. If it suggests getting rid of something unwanted, 'DISCARD' or 'SHED' might fit. Always consider synonyms and antonyms of "cast off" and how they might fit the puzzle's theme or other intersecting words.
